Renowned for their theatrical live shows, masked occult rockers Ghost captured a thrilling performance in San Francisco featuring some of their finest satanic hymns. Kicking off with the bombastic 2016 single “Square Hammer” and working their way through the Swedish band’s devilish discography, vocalist Papa Emeritus III and his troupe of Nameless Ghouls pump demonic electricity into soaring devotional “Body and Blood,” metallic incantation “Year Zero,” mournful, orchestral pop song “He Is,” and infectious audience sing-along “Monstrance Clock.”
